John Lewis

John Lewis is well known for its "Never Knowingly Undersold" promise which promises to reimburse customers the difference in the event that they find a better price on a different street or Vac Filter Vf7000 on the internet. This may seem like a typical price-leadership strategy but it's actually a great way of increasing sales and establishing customer loyalty. John Lewis has a large variety of merchandise so that customers are able to find the items they're searching for.

The company operates a chain of stores that includes Waitrose supermarkets, in addition to its traditional department store. The website features a wide range of products including its own brand. It also features special promotions and coupons. The design of the website is user-friendly and easy to navigate.

The company's multichannel approach to retail has proven successful, allowing it to gain a competitive advantage over its competition. It has a mobile site, which enables shoppers to look up product information on their smartphones and make purchases at their convenience. Additionally, it offers click and collect for purchases made through its website. This has led to incremental sales in-store and online.

Misguided

If you're looking to revamp your summer wardrobe without draining your bank account, look no further than Missguided. This Manchester-based ecommerce retailer offers trendy styles at a reasonable price. If you're looking for a bodycon velvet dress, or an edgy mini skirt, the Missguided collection is sure to have something to suit your needs.

The first time the retailer was launched was in 2009 and was established by Nitin Passi. It quickly gained traction thanks to its bold voice and ingenuous social strategies. In 2017, it opened its first ever physical store in London's Westfield Stratford. The store was designed as a television studio with an "on-air" concept.

It became clear that the company had serious financial difficulties when a number of its suppliers owed thousands pounds. It also faced ruthless competition from fast fashion rivals like Shein. It was eventually sold to Frasers for the sum of P25,1 million. The Missguided website and brand name were saved.

However, the damage has already been done to the reputation of the brand. Some suppliers were forced to sell their own jewellery to pay for orders, while others were forced send their employees home. One factory owner said that he was forced to sell the family's heirlooms in order to pay for the company's debt.
